About This Item

Iowa City: The Stone Wall Press, 1973. First edition. Softcover. Near fine. First edition. Softcover. 1`0 7/8'' x 8 1/4''. Unpaginated. One hundred and fifty copies have been printed by hand on a Washington press. The type is Bembo ; the paper is handmade Crown & Sceptre. The improvisation follows the poem and translation, on a page that folds out. Some minor toning to cover.
